Preguntas frecuentes sobre Ridgewood Park
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Ridgewood Park?
Actualmente hay 16 Apartamentos Estudios en Ridgewood Park con alquileres que van desde $760 hasta $1,560, con un precio medio de $1,261.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Ridgewood Park?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Ridgewood Park varian entre $999 y $4,995 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,868
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Ridgewood Park?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Ridgewood Park van desde $1,299 hasta $5,627.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,189
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Ridgewood Park?
En estos momentos hay 17 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Ridgewood Park en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,716 y $6,515 - con una media de $3,233 para el lugar.
